66import org .variantsync .diffdetective .show .engine .GameEngine ;
77import org .variantsync .diffdetective .show .engine .geom .Vec2 ;
88import org .variantsync .diffdetective .show .variation .VariationDiffApp ;
9- import org .variantsync .diffdetective .util .Source ;
109import org .variantsync .diffdetective .variation .Label ;
1110import org .variantsync .diffdetective .variation .diff .DiffNode ;
1211import org .variantsync .diffdetective .variation .diff .VariationDiff ;
@@ -31,7 +30,7 @@ public static GameEngine diff(final VariationDiff<?> d, final String title) {
3130 }
3231
3332 public static GameEngine diff (final VariationDiff <?> d ) {
34- return diff (d , Source . shortExplanation ( d ));
33+ return diff (d , d . getSource (). functionExplanation ( ));
3534 }
3635
3736 public static <L extends Label > GameEngine tree (final VariationTree <L > t , final String title , List <DiffNodeLabelFormat <L >> availableFormats ) {
@@ -48,7 +47,7 @@ public static GameEngine tree(final VariationTree<?> t, final String title) {
4847 }
4948
5049 public static GameEngine tree (final VariationTree <?> t ) {
51- return tree (t , Source . shortExplanation ( t ));
50+ return tree (t , t . getSource (). functionExplanation ( ));
5251 }
5352
5453 public static <L extends Label > GameEngine baddiff (final BadVDiff <L > badVDiff , final String title , List <DiffNodeLabelFormat <L >> availableFormats ) {
@@ -81,6 +80,6 @@ public static GameEngine baddiff(final BadVDiff<?> badVDiff, final String title)
8180 }
8281
8382 public static GameEngine baddiff (final BadVDiff <?> badVDiff ) {
84- return baddiff (badVDiff , Source . shortExplanation ( badVDiff .diff () ));
83+ return baddiff (badVDiff , badVDiff .functionExplanation ( ));
8584 }
8685}
0 commit comments